摘要
为了提高高性能胶结材料的强度,试验对硅灰、粉煤灰等材料的掺配比例不同时的胶结材料抗折强度、抗压强度影响规律进行了研究,结果显示:掺入粉煤灰和硅灰取代部分水泥用量,可较好地改善胶结材料的强度和工作性能。
